1. Mugunghwaย (๋ฌด๊ถํ): The National Flower of South Koreaย
The Mugunghwa (๋ฌด๊ถํ), or hibiscus syriacus, is the national flower of South Korea. Known for its resilience and beauty, this flower symbolizes the strength and perseverance of the Korean people. The Mugunghwa appears in the national anthem and the countryโs national emblem, representing South Koreaโs growth and enduring spirit.

2. The Tigerย (ํธ๋์ด): A Powerful Symbol of South Koreaย
The tiger (ํธ๋์ด) holds a special place in Korean culture, symbolizing strength, courage, and protection. Known as Sansin (์ฐ์ ), the tiger is a guardian of the mountains in Korean mythology. The tiger also serves as the mascot for major South Korean sports events, including the 1988 Seoul Summer Olympics and the 2018 Pyeongchang Winter Olympics.

3. Hanbokย (ํ๋ณต): Traditional Korean Clothingย
The Hanbok (ํ๋ณต) is the traditional clothing of South Korea, known for its vibrant colors and flowing designs. This graceful attire reflects Korean cultural values of modesty and beauty. Often worn during celebrations and festivals, the Hanbok has become an iconic symbol of Korean heritage and continues to be loved both domestically and internationally.

4. Hanokย (ํ์ฅ): Traditional Korean Architectureย
Hanok (ํ์ฅ) is a traditional Korean house that embodies the simplicity and harmony with nature. Constructed from natural materials such as wood, stone, and straw, Hanok homes have been designed to adapt to Koreaโs seasonal changes. Today, you can visit Hanok villages like Bukchon (๋ถ์ด) and Jeonju (์ ์ฃผ), where this ancient architectural style is preserved amidst modern cities.

5. Kimchiย (๊น์น): The Soul of Korean Cuisineย
No mention of South Korean cuisine is complete without Kimchi (๊น์น). This spicy, fermented vegetable dish is a symbol of Koreaโs culinary heritage. Made primarily from napa cabbage and radishes, Kimchi is an essential side dish in Korean meals and holds deep cultural significance. The process of making Kimchi (known as Kimjang ๊น์ฅ) is a time-honored tradition that brings families together during the winter months.

6. Ginsengย (์ธ์ผ): A Health Miracle from Koreaย
Ginseng (์ธ์ผ) is another notable symbol of South Korea, renowned for its health benefits. Grown in Koreaโs fertile soil, Korean ginseng is considered one of the best in the world. Used in everything from teas to health supplements, ginseng has become an integral part of Korean culture and is often referred to as one of South Koreaโs national treasures.

7. Taekwondoย (ํ๊ถ๋): The Martial Art of South Koreaย
Taekwondo (ํ๊ถ๋), the Korean martial art, is not only a popular sport but also a symbol of South Korean culture. Known for its powerful kicks and disciplined training, Taekwondo emphasizes both physical fitness and mental strength. It is practiced worldwide and represents the spirit of Korea in martial arts.

8. Pansoriย (ํ์๋ฆฌ): Korean Traditional Storytelling Musicย
Pansori (ํ์๋ฆฌ) is a unique genre of Korean traditional performance art that combines singing and storytelling. Recognized by UNESCO as an Intangible Cultural Heritage, Pansori performances are emotional and captivating, often telling stories from Korean folklore through powerful vocalizations and drum beats.

9. Jeju Islandย (์ ์ฃผ๋): South Korea's Natural Paradiseย
Jeju Island (์ ์ฃผ๋) is a beautiful volcanic island off the southern coast of Korea. Known for its stunning landscapes, including Hallasan Mountain (ํ๋ผ์ฐ) and Seongsan Ilchulbong (์ฑ์ฐ์ผ์ถ๋ด), Jeju is a symbol of South Koreaโs natural beauty. Its unique climate and vibrant flora and fauna make it one of the most sought-after destinations for both locals and international travelers.

10. Samsungย (์ผ์ฑ): A Global Tech Leader from South Koreaย
Samsung (์ผ์ฑ) is a global giant and a key symbol of South Korea's technological advancement. Founded in 1938, Samsung has become a leader in consumer electronics, smartphones, and digital technology. Known for its innovation and excellence, Samsung represents South Koreaโs global presence and economic power.
